All, I am pleased to annouce the release of v1.0 of the WFRP Ruleset for Fantasy Grounds II. This ruleset provides all the necessary tools in order for a GM to host a session using Fantasy Grounds. It contains the following features:
* Dice roller and dice pool builder for the WFRP custom dice.
* Fully featured character sheet, including sections to enter all talents, actions and conditions
* Party sheet mechanic allowing the GM to track party tension and fortune
* An initiative tracker allowing the GM and players to keep track of both combat and social encounters
* Drag and drop support throughout - A set of custom tokens on the desktop can be quickly used to drag and drop wounds, stress, fatigue, power, favour, and wealth to any character portrait, character sheet, NPC or token.
* A set of desktop cards which, when used in conjunction with a library module, allow players and GMs to randomly draw criticals, conditions, insanities, mutations, miscasts, and diseases.
* NPC group sheets for tracking creature and nemesis group organisations.
* Ability for a GM to share images and maps with players, with full support for tokens, pointers, and drawings.
* Ability for a GM to export a campaign and create Adventure Modules.
In addition to the ruleset, I have also created the following :
* A PDF document that provides an overview of the ruleset, how to use it, plus notes on how to create and edit your own library and adventure modules.
* A template library module which can be used as a starting point for GMs to enter their own card information.
* An example adventure module based on the introductary scenario "A Day Late, A Shilling Short"
* Image templates to assist in creating your own tokens and location cards.
Note that I wont be stopping at v1.0 - I already have a list of additional features to add for v1.1. These will mainly cover the new rules add as part of Black Fire Pass.

The PDN files are Paint.Net Files - Paint.Net is a free, open source, image editing package. The PDN files are layered images which include a layer for the image mask, bevel highlight, and stand-up. They are the original image files that I use for creating my own tokens and location cards.Quote:

The provided library module gives examples of each type of 'content' that the ruleset supports - Action cards, Talent Cards, Careers, NPCs, Locations, Items, etc. The library shows all the attributes that are available for each card. In addition, the "Day Late, Shilling Short" adventure module also provides examples of actual action cards for the NPCs.Quote:
